what is frederick douglasss tone after he is transferred to baltimore?

a. angry

b. emotionless

c. sad

d. grateful

Explanation:

Brief Explanations

In Frederick Douglass's narrative, his transfer to Baltimore is a positive turning point. He views it as an opportunity, and his tone reflects gratitude for the change in his circumstances (better treatment, access to learning opportunities compared to his previous situation). Angry, emotionless, or sad don't align with his perspective on this transfer.

Answer:

D. Grateful
